The blockchain ecosystem relies on two critical phases before any network becomes operational at scale. While a testnet serves as the experimental playground where developers validate ideas and identify vulnerabilities, a mainnet represents the fully operational, production-ready version. The key distinction is that a testnet typically operates as a simulated environment—often layered on top of existing blockchain infrastructure—whereas a mainnet functions as an independent, standalone network capable of processing real-world transactions.
The Mainnet Explained: Full Functionality and Real Value Transfer
When a blockchain network reaches mainnet status, it transitions from theoretical development to practical deployment. At this stage, the protocol is no longer a work in progress but a completed system ready for commercial deployment. A mainnet enables actual data and asset transfers across its network, with all transactions recorded and verified by network participants in real-time.
The mainnet version operates independently, maintaining its own consensus mechanism and distributed ledger. Users can execute genuine transactions, transfer value, and interact with smart contracts without simulation or testing restrictions. Every transaction processed on the mainnet is permanent and secured by the blockchain’s cryptographic infrastructure.
From Development to Deployment: The Mainnet Journey
Before developers release a mainnet, they conduct extensive testing phases. During testnet operations, teams implement new features, troubleshoot potential issues, and refine the protocol. Once development reaches completion and all critical vulnerabilities are addressed, the blockchain transitions to mainnet launch.
This progression ensures that when a mainnet goes live, the network is robust enough to handle real-world applications and user activity. The mainnet version serves as the foundation for decentralized applications, financial services, and other blockchain-based solutions that require stability and security.
Why Mainnet Matters
The mainnet is where blockchain technology moves from innovation to implementation. Unlike testnet environments designed for experimentation, a mainnet is the live protocol that users trust with actual assets and transactions. This distinction—between a developmental version and a fully operational network—defines the maturity and readiness of any blockchain project for mainstream adoption.
